Squid are an English post-punk band formed in Brighton. Their debut album Bright Green Field was released in 2021 on Warp Records.

Signed to Warp Records; debut album Bright Green Field (2021); originated in Brighton; Town Centre EP (2019) preceded the album.

Two DeBaser reviews cover Squid's Town Centre EP and their 2021 debut Bright Green Field. Critics praise the band's eclectic post-punk sound, vocalist/drummer Ollie Judge, and compositional ambition. Bright Green Field is noted for its anti-capitalist lyrical bent and wide-ranging influences. Town Centre is highlighted for its variety across four concise tracks.
